Why Convert SVG to TIFF?
Professional print workflows often require TIFF format for consistency and predictability. While SVG is resolution-independent, TIFF provides a fixed, high-resolution raster that prints identically across all systems. Print shops may not have SVG rendering capabilities or may require standardized TIFF submissions.
TIFF also supports CMYK color mode used in commercial printing, embedded color profiles, and maintains lossless quality through multiple edits—features essential for print production that SVG handles differently.

How the Conversion Works
Converting SVG to TIFF involves rendering the vector graphics to a high-resolution pixel grid (rasterization). The SVG's mathematical descriptions of shapes, colors, and effects are calculated at each pixel position to create the raster image. TIFF then stores these pixels with lossless compression.
The conversion captures SVG's appearance at a specific resolution, typically 300 DPI for print. Unlike SVG, the resulting TIFF cannot be scaled up without quality loss—but it provides the fixed, predictable output that professional print workflows require.
